School neither taking fees nor resolving the issue

A kid studying ub CBSE school Karnataka, school is charging more for annual fees and fees.

Many parents raised voice over annual fees & tuition fees and contacted principle.  The principle of the school from past 6 months said they will resolve it.  Even after 6 months no response from school, sent circular to collect the fees for all parents and now the school is not accepting any fees from the who raised voice (parents).

Principal is saying, school fees will be collected after he resolving the issue. He is not giving in writing for the same.

Our concern is school may not allow kids for exam and even if they write exam they may not go for next academic.

Kindly suggest how to tackle this issue. Which Act or law can save these kids.
